CVE-2018-14655

20
FAUCET Score

CVE-2018-14655 is a c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ability affecting Keycloak versions 3.4.3.Final, 4.0.0.Beta2, and 4.3.0.Final, as well as Red Hat Linux and Single Sign-On. An attacker can inject arbitrary JavaScript code via the 'state' parameter when 'response_mode=form_post' is used, leading to an XSS attack upon successful login. With a CVSS score of 5.4 (Medium), this vulnerability requires user interaction and successful authentication, but could lead to limited confidentiality and integrity impacts. There is no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), or significant community discussion surrounding this CVE.
